Abstract
Canopy density estimation based on the empirical method using remote sensing data needs field measurement of canopy density data. There are several methods to obtain canopy density data, and it can be divided into downward and upward measurement. Those two methods have different term used, and it is possible to produce different result. This study aims to compare aerial photography from UAV and hemispherical photography that represent downward and upward method, respectively. The results showed downward method produces the higher canopy density than upward method. The regression analysis showed upward method provides the better method in canopy density estimation, however the term of downward measurement is more appropriate to canopy density term
